Comprehending Warehouse Setup Offerings

Warehouse installation services encompass a range of specialized activities designed to set up and optimize storage systems within a facility. These offerings usually involve the design, arrangement, and construction of storage shelves, racking structures, and other critical warehouse fixtures. Experts in this area evaluate the specific requirements of every facility, considering elements like stock varieties, spatial limitations, and workflow processes.

Furthermore, warehouse installation services entail the thorough integration of technology, including inventory management systems and automated solutions, to enhance efficiency. The process may also involve the installation of safety features and compliance measures, guaranteeing that all systems comply with regulatory standards. By engaging skilled technicians, these services seek to create a streamlined storage environment that maximizes space utilization. Finally, effective warehouse installation establishes the groundwork for better accessibility and organization, essential for maintaining operational efficiency in any warehousing operation.

Vital Parts of Warehouse Systems

Effective warehouse systems are constructed on several key components that work together to improve overall functionality and productivity. At the core is the layout, which controls the flow of goods and accessibility of inventory. A thoughtfully structured layout decreases travel time and increases space utilization. Storage solutions, such as pallet racks and shelving units, are essential for managing products effectively.

Moreover, presentation inventory management systems play an important role in tracking stock levels, facilitating replenishment, and minimizing errors. Adequate material handling equipment, like forklifts and conveyor systems, provides safe and efficient movement of goods.

In addition, safety measures and gear, including fire suppression systems and personal protective gear, are necessary to shield employees and assets. In conclusion, effective communication tools, for example radios and digital displays, strengthen coordination among staff. Collectively, these components build a robust warehouse system that drives efficiency and productivity, ultimately supporting an organization's operational goals.

The Role of Automation in Warehouse Efficiency

Automated systems greatly increase warehouse efficiency by streamlining operations and decreasing manual labor. By introducing automated systems, warehouses can enhance inventory management, boost order fulfillment, and reduce errors. Solutions including robotic picking systems, conveyor belts, and automated storage and retrieval systems support faster processing and movement of goods.

Moreover, automation enables real-time data tracking, providing accurate inventory levels and improved decision-making. With integrated software solutions, warehouses can analyze performance metrics, identify bottlenecks, and adapt operations as needed.

Furthermore, automation helps reduce operational costs by decreasing labor expenses and reducing the risk of injuries linked to manual handling. It also empowers staff to dedicate themselves to more strategic tasks that require human judgment, consequently fostering a more productive work environment. Overall, the adoption of automation in warehouse operations produces significant improvements in efficiency, productivity, and overall competitiveness in the market.

What Is the Duration of a Standard Warehouse Installation Project?

A typical warehouse installation project usually takes between several weeks to a few months, depending on factors such as complexity, size, and unique needs. Proper planning and coordination can greatly influence the complete schedule.

How Much Do Warehouse Installation Services Typically Cost?

The average cost of warehouse installation services usually falls between $10,000 and $100,000, based on factors such as the project's scope, intricacy, and particular needs, impacting overall pricing and available options for clients.

Do You Need Permits for Warehouse Installation?

Indeed, permits are usually necessary for warehouse installation, depending by location and project scope. Local regulations may mandate building permits, zoning approvals, and safety inspections to verify compliance with building regulations and operational protocols.

What Is the Ideal Schedule for Updating or Maintaining Warehouse Systems?

Warehouse systems should be updated or maintained at least annually, with more frequent checks recommended based on usage levels and operational requirements. Regular maintenance ensures optimal performance, prolongs equipment lifespan, and enhances overall safety and efficiency.
